当前位置:Gxlcms > PHP教程 > PHP可以检测用户浏览器所使用语言的代码片段

PHP可以检测用户浏览器所使用语言的代码片段

时间:2021-07-01 10:21:17 帮助过:4人阅读

使用下面的 PHP 代码片段可以检测用户浏览器所使用的语言

  1. function get_client_language($availableLanguages, $default='en'){
  2. if (isset($_SERVER['HTTP_ACCEPT_LANGUAGE'])) {
  3. $langs=explode(',',$_SERVER['HTTP_ACCEPT_LANGUAGE']);
  4. foreach ($langs as $value){
  5. $choice=substr($value,0,2);
  6. if(in_array($choice, $availableLanguages)){
  7. return $choice;
  8. }
  9. }
  10. }
  11. return $default;
  12. }

PHP

人气教程排行